Job summary

Jobtailor is seeking a healthcare Revenue Cycle specialist to lead and optimize insurance authorization workflows in California, ensuring timely payer authorizations and reducing denials. You will collaborate with payers and internal teams to scale processes, monitor performance, and implement policy changes across EHR and practice management systems.

Strong communication and project leadership are essential.

Job description

  • Support the development, implementation, and integration of authorization workflows within Revenue Cycle
  • Manage complex authorization processes and ensure services are authorized within payer-required timeframes
  • Monitor authorization workflows, work queues, turnaround times, missing or expiring authorizations, and outstanding requests
  • Research and interpret payer authorization requirements and incorporate them into workflows
  • Resolve missing, incomplete, or expiring authorizations with operational teams
  • Identify authorization issues contributing to claim denials, delayed reimbursement, and revenue loss
  • Collaborate with payers, Revenue Cycle, and operational teams to resolve complex authorization barriers
  • Develop processes to reduce authorization-related denials and prevent avoidable revenue loss
  • Support integration of authorization functions into Revenue Cycle, including workflows, documentation, controls, and cross-functional processes
  • Support authorization processes for new payers, contracts, programs, services, and changing payer requirements
  • Serve as a subject matter resource for authorization processes, workflows, and payer requirements
  • Lead and coordinate complex authorization and Revenue Cycle projects, workflow implementations, payer initiatives, process improvements, and system enhancements
  • Develop project plans, coordinate stakeholders, monitor timelines and deliverables, identify barriers, and drive projects to completion
  • Analyze authorization processes, operational data, and performance trends to improve efficiency, accuracy, reimbursement, and financial performance
  • Develop and implement workflow improvements and Revenue Cycle policies, procedures, workflows, and process standards
  • Partner with Revenue Cycle, Finance, Data, and operational leadership to resolve complex issues
  • Oversee processing and tracking of Community Supports housing-related deposits
  • Ensure housing deposit requests are complete, accurately documented, and processed timely
  • Monitor unresolved housing deposit items and coordinate follow-up through resolution
  • Support consistent authorization processes with the Authorization & Denial Specialist and Revenue Cycle team
  • Develop resources, documentation, and training materials
  • Communicate process changes, payer requirements, and identified issues to stakeholders
  • Perform other assigned duties and projects
